REQUIREMENTS ABILITY COUNTS IN THE A.N.Z. BANK Australia and New Zealand Bank Ltd., HAS VACANCIES FOR A LIMITED NUMBER OF BOYS Applicants must have School Certificate but those with University Entrance will be preferred. Keenness, ambitions and ability are they key requirements. More than one tn five of A.N.Z. male staff ts a Branch Accountant, manager, or higher executive. No Manager receives less than £lBOO per annum in emoluments, most earn considerably more. A minimum salary scale Is payable to all male staff reaching £ll5O at the age of 33.
